The vision and direction
of the Centre is guided by the Directors, both of whom are
Practitioners at GNHC.
GNHC
aims to provide a happy and mutually supportive space for Practitioners
to develop their practices.
We offer a mentoring
system to give support where necessary.
We encourage cross
referral
within the Centre so that we can provide a better service to our clients
and improve our own knowledge of the value of other disciplines.
The day-to-day management
is undertaken by the Directors
assisted by the Practice Manager, Senior Receptionist
and two part-time Receptionists.

| Our Business Model |
All Practitioners work on a self employed basis, renting practice room space
from The Greenwich Natural Health Centre Ltd.
Practitioners
book regular Sessions, comprising four consecutive working hours. The
day is divided into 3 Sessions: Morning (09:00-13:00), Afternoon
(13:30-17:30) and Evening (18:00-22:00).
Booking
a Session is a commitment by the Practitioner to pay
rent for that particular Session on a recurring basis. One months notice
is required to cancel and relinquish a Session.
Rent is calculated as either: 25% of total Session earnings or a £30.00 Minimum Reservation Charge, whichever is the greater.
A new Practitioner pays only 25% of Session earnings for the first month to
help
them establish their practice.
Practitioners
also pay an additional £12 per month from their start date into
the advertising fund, which is primarily web based.
Each Practitioner is provided with a Day Book to record appointments and fees. The Day Book is used to calculate rent due.
Reception staff, adminstrative support, practice room preparation and monthly account statements are provided.
Practitioners
must only practise the therapy as agreed at their start date. No other
therapy may practised without the prior consent of the Directors of the
Greenwich Natural Health Centre Ltd.

| Interested in becoming a Practitioner
at the Greenwich Natural Health Centre? |
Listed below are the criteria for prospective practitioners at the Greenwich Natural Health Centre:
1) The
Practitioner should hold appropriate qualifications for practising
their given
therapy. The Practitioner may only practise the therapy in which they
are trained and are applying to practise within GNHC.
2) The Practitioner
must have valid certification in their particular therapy, a current
valid insurance certificate and a current valid first aid certificate.
3)
The Practitioner should have a minimum of
two years postgraduate experience in their chosen field, however
due consideration may be given to newly qualified applicants.
4) The
Practitioner should have an existing client list. They should have sufficient clients to make at least one
booking for each session worked.
5) The Practitioner should give
consideration as to how they will increase their client list. They
should also provide a one page marketing and business plan.
Participation in GNHC events
and meetings is expected.
6) The Practitioner should be
committed to the principle of holistic health care and willing to
work in co-operation with other therapists, referring clients to other
practitioners within GNHC where appropriate.
7) The Practitioner will undertake personal on-going
Continual Professional Development (CPD).
